GreenGeeks Hosting Review 2025 – What Makes It Unique?

GreenGeeks is widely regarded as one of the best eco-friendly web hosting providers in the industry. Founded in 2008, it powers over 600,000 websites and is known for matching 300% of its energy usage with renewable wind energy. In fact, for every unit of electricity consumed, they reinvest three units of renewable energy back into the grid. This makes GreenGeeks not just carbon neutral, but carbon-reducing.

From shared hosting to VPS and reseller options, GreenGeeks targets developers, bloggers, and eCommerce site owners who want sustainability without compromising performance. Their WordPress hosting comes with LiteSpeed-powered servers, free CDN, free migrations, and one-click installs.

InMotion Hosting – A Legacy Hosting Company That’s Still Innovating

Founded in 2001, InMotion Hosting is a veteran in the hosting space with a reputation built on reliable support, technical robustness, and business-class hosting solutions. They were among the first to introduce SSD storage as a standard and are A+ rated by the Better Business Bureau for over a decade.

Their WordPress hosting leverages UltraStack technology, custom caching, and multiple data centers. InMotion is a solid choice for businesses scaling up, thanks to its developer-friendly features (SSH access, staging, Git integration) and long 90-day money-back guarantee.

Data Centers & Infrastructure: GreenGeeks vs InMotion Hosting

GreenGeeks operates five strategically located data centers in the U.S., Canada, Europe, and Asia. This global reach helps websites load faster for international audiences. Their infrastructure is powered by Intel Xeon processors, RAID-10 SSD storage, and is optimized with LiteSpeed and LSCache—a performance duo known for speeding up WordPress and WooCommerce sites.

In contrast, InMotion operates three data centers in the U.S. and Europe. While fewer in number, their UltraStack architecture is designed for speed and scalability. It layers NGINX reverse proxy, PHP-FPM, and advanced caching to ensure optimal performance even during traffic spikes.

Verdict:
GreenGeeks offers more global data center options and enhanced eco-infrastructure, while InMotion focuses on deep optimization within fewer, high-performance centers.

Page Load Speeds on Shared WordPress Plans

GreenGeeks has built its WordPress plans around LiteSpeed servers, integrated with LSCache—a WordPress-specific caching tool that significantly improves Time To First Byte (TTFB) and overall load times. In real-world testing, WordPress sites hosted on GreenGeeks consistently load in under 700ms, which meets Google’s Core Web Vitals benchmark.

Their automatic updates, optimized PHP (v8.2), and free Cloudflare CDN also contribute to snappier site delivery—even under moderate traffic loads. For most bloggers, agencies, or small businesses, GreenGeeks is fast enough to deliver a seamless user experience.

InMotion Hosting, on the other hand, takes a more layered approach with its UltraStack infrastructure. It includes NGINX, PHP-FPM, and Brotli compression, giving it a slight speed edge, especially on dynamic content. WordPress installs are isolated in containers, ensuring resource consistency even during traffic surges.

In head-to-head comparisons of GreenGeeks vs InMotion for WordPress speed, InMotion loads about 80ms faster on average, especially for U.S.-based traffic. However, GreenGeeks holds its own with better global reach due to more data center locations.

PHP Versions, Caching, and CDN Integrations

Both hosting providers offer the latest PHP versions, currently up to PHP 8.2, which boosts performance and security for WordPress websites.

  • GreenGeeks includes LSCache, server-level caching, and free integration with Cloudflare CDN, ideal for reducing latency for global visitors.
  • InMotion features object caching and premium CDN options on higher-tier plans. Their BoldGrid WordPress plugin also includes built-in optimization tools, though it may not be as fast as LSCache for high-traffic sites.

For developers and power users, InMotion’s WordPress hosting allows advanced configurations like WP-CLI, SSH access, and Git integration. GreenGeeks also supports these but aims for simplicity and environmental impact as primary differentiators.

GreenGeeks’ 300% Wind Energy Match (Carbon-Neutral Hosting)

GreenGeeks isn’t just participating in green hosting—it’s leading it.

For every unit of energy their servers consume, they purchase three times that amount in wind energy credits, effectively putting clean energy back into the grid. This 300% offset makes GreenGeeks one of the few web hosts that go beyond carbon neutrality to become carbon-reducing.

They’ve also partnered with One Tree Planted, planting trees for every new hosting account. These efforts make GreenGeeks a top choice for businesses focused on sustainability and carbon-free digital footprints.

Moreover, their green badge can be displayed on your site to show your environmental commitment—something that resonates with modern, eco-conscious consumers.

InMotion’s LA Data Center & Energy-Saving Initiatives

InMotion Hosting has also made strides toward sustainability. Their Los Angeles data center uses advanced outside air cooling, which cuts down energy consumption by 70% and reduces CO₂ output by over 2,000 tons per year.

InMotion reduces paper usage internally, increases recycling, and implements eco-friendly shipping and office practices. While not as aggressive in their green marketing as GreenGeeks, their actual practices reflect a serious commitment to cleaner hosting.

GreenGeeks vs InMotion: Security Features and Site Protection

Security isn’t optional in 2025—it’s essential. With WordPress sites facing increasing threats, you need a host that offers more than just SSL and firewalls. This section breaks down the security comparison between GreenGeeks and InMotion Hosting.

SSL, Malware Protection, and Backup Tools

Both GreenGeeks and InMotion include:

  • Free SSL certificates
  • Automatic daily backups
  • Proactive malware scanning
  • Brute-force protection

But GreenGeeks takes it a step further with real-time file scanning, account isolation, and a custom firewall tuned specifically for WordPress environments.

InMotion Hosting also offers strong protection via Corero DDoS mitigation and Smartwall Technology, especially beneficial for business and eCommerce users.

What’s more, InMotion includes SSH access, hotlink protection, and Leech protection for advanced users, while GreenGeeks includes SiteLock (optional) for deeper scanning and automated patching.

SiteLock, SSH Access, and Advanced Firewalls

  • GreenGeeks: SiteLock available on-demand, with enhanced security layers on WordPress plans. Also includes container-based account isolation, limiting damage from neighbor account breaches.
  • InMotion: Offers more tools for developers, including configurable firewalls, root access on VPS, and easy credential reset via dashboard.

While both are among the best secure WordPress hosting providers, GreenGeeks is more automated and beginner-friendly in its approach. InMotion caters better to developers who want granular control over security policies.

cPanel, Staging, Email, FTP, and Developer Access

Both GreenGeeks and InMotion offer cPanel access, which makes site management easier for beginners and developers alike. But let’s dig deeper.

GreenGeeks Developer Toolkit:

  • Unlimited FTP accounts
  • SSH access, Git integration
  • Support for multiple PHP versions (5.6 to 8.2)
  • 1-click installer for 150+ apps
  • MySQL, PostgreSQL, and cron jobs
  • Built-in staging environment for WordPress
  • Unlimited email accounts with Webmail support

What makes GreenGeeks particularly attractive for developers is its developer-friendly shared hosting, something many other green hosts lack. You can spin up multiple dev environments easily with minimal cost.

InMotion Hosting for Business Websites:

InMotion takes it up a notch with their developer-grade tools:

  • Integrated Git, WP-CLI, SSH, and SFTP
  • Dedicated staging and cloning environments
  • Node.js, Ruby, Python, and Perl support
  • Advanced caching controls through UltraStack
  • Free dedicated IP (on higher plans)
  • Email spam filtering and third-party email integration
  • Business-class security for client sites

InMotion’s Power and Pro plans are tailored for small businesses and agencies needing reliability, white-label management, and scalable infrastructure.

GreenGeeks vs InMotion: Traffic Handling and Scalability

Your hosting provider must be able to support your website’s growth. Whether you start with 100 visitors a day or scale to 10,000, performance shouldn’t suffer. Here’s how GreenGeeks and InMotion Hosting handle high traffic in 2025.

How Many Visitors Can Shared Plans Handle?

GreenGeeks doesn’t impose strict visitor caps. Thanks to their use of LiteSpeed servers and account isolation, even shared hosting users can handle up to 50,000 monthly visits on the Lite plan, and 100,000+ visits/month on higher-tier plans (Pro and Premium).

If your site starts to receive consistent high traffic, they recommend upgrading to their ECO Premium plan, which comes with 4x performance, more server resources, and better handling of dynamic content (great for WooCommerce and blogs with high engagement).

InMotion Hosting’s shared Power and Pro plans are built for businesses and medium-traffic websites. With UltraStack caching, PHP-FPM, and performance-optimized data centers, shared plans can support up to 100,000 visits/month comfortably.

If you go beyond that, InMotion recommends scaling to their VPS or Managed WordPress plans, which come with isolated resources, root access, and dedicated IP addresses.

When to Upgrade to VPS or Managed Hosting?

  • GreenGeeks: Upgrade when you cross 100K visits/month or need custom server configurations.
  • InMotion: Upgrade if your traffic regularly spikes above 80–100K/month, or if your WordPress site needs dedicated resource allocation and staging.
